Study Summary

This phase IIa trial studies how well aspirin works in preventing colorectal cancer in patients with colorectal adenoma. Aspirin may stop the growth of tumor cells by blocking some of the enzymes needed for cell growth.

Primary Outcome

Change in the ratio of proliferation to apoptosis biomarkers (Ki67 density index: BAX density index, measured continuously after IHC staining) in colorectal mucosa of compliant participants
